S.2167
Title: A bill to amend the Energy Policy and Conservation Act to provide for Federal energy conservation standards for flourescent lamp ballasts.
Sponsor: Sen Metzenbaum, Howard M. [OH] (introduced 3/15/1988)      Cosponsors (26)
Related Bills: H.R.4158
Latest Major Action: 6/28/1988 Became Public Law No: 100-357.

SUMMARY AS OF:
5/19/1988--Passed Senate amended.    (There are 2 other summaries)

(Measure passed Senate, amended)

National Appliance Energy Conservation Amendments of 1988 - Amends the Energy Policy and Conservation Act to include fluorescent lamp ballasts within the list of products covered by the Act. Amends the definition of "consumer product" to include fluorescent lamp ballasts distributed in commerce for personal or commercial use or consumption.

Directs the Secretary of Energy to prescribe test procedures for such ballasts manufactured on or after January 1, 1990. Directs the Federal Trade Commission to prescribe labeling rules for such ballasts according to specified guidelines. Sets forth energy efficiency standards for such ballasts. Preempts State energy conservation standards for such ballasts unless such standards were prescribed or enacted before the date of enactment of this Act.


MAJOR ACTIONS:

3/15/1988 Introduced in Senate
5/13/1988 Committee on Energy and Natural Resources. Reported to Senate by Senator Johnston with amendments. With written report No. 100-345.
5/19/1988 Passed/agreed to in Senate: Passed Senate with amendments by Voice Vote.
6/13/1988 House Committee on Energy and Commerce Discharged by Unanimous Consent.
6/13/1988 Passed/agreed to in House: Passed House by Voice Vote.
6/13/1988 Cleared for White House.
6/17/1988 Presented to President.
6/28/1988 Signed by President.
6/28/1988 Became Public Law No: 100-357.
